Understanding Mobility Scooters

Mobility scooters are electric-powered devices developed to assist people with minimal mobility. They come in numerous shapes and sizes, including various abilities. Secret components consist of:

  • Chassis: The frame that supports the scooter’s structure.
  • Wheels: Designed for indoor or outside use, depending upon the model.
  • Seat: Often cushioned for comfort, with adjustable height alternatives.
  • Controls: Handheld controls enable for velocity, braking, and steering.

Types of Mobility Scooters

Mobility scooters can typically be classified into 3 types:

  1. Travel Scooters

    • Lightweight and portable
    • Developed for simple disassembly or folding
    • Perfect for short trips and air travel
  2. Mid-size Scooters

    • Provides a balance in between portable and robust functions
    • Ideal for indoor and outside usage
    • Typically can take a trip moderate distances
  3. Durable Scooters

    • Constructed to support larger weights and travel longer ranges
    • Sturdier building and construction
    • Functions higher-capacity batteries
Type of Scooter Weight Capacity Range (Miles) Ideal Use
Travel Scooters Approximately 300 lbs 6-10 Short journeys, indoor
Mid-size Scooters As much as 400 lbs 15-25 Daily errands
Sturdy Scooters 400 lbs + 25-35 Longer ranges

Upkeep Tips for Mobility Scooters

To guarantee longevity and optimal efficiency, routine upkeep is vital. Here are some important maintenance tips:

  • Regular Battery Checks: Monitor battery health to prevent unexpected shut-downs.
  • Tire Inflation: Ensure that pneumatic tires are sufficiently pumped up.
  • Cleaning: Keep the scooter clean and devoid of debris to avoid mechanical concerns.
  • Examine Lights: If equipped, make sure that headlights and taillights are working.
